Guest Guest Posted March 30, 2008 Well, there are things that I like here: Half diagonal composition, very good exposure in not so easy situation, good shines on the leather and the girl is probably my favorite of your models. I also like the set, it sort of frames her. The thing I don't like is the outfit contra the pose - it's like she'd been built from three replaceable parts: the legs, the mid torso and the part above the waist. I think it's actually the the lower edge of the jacket on the front side that interrupts her logical contours. The pose also makes me question about the height of her neck. But in anycase, I like the shot. You are truly very good at shooting on site with small master/slave-flashes.Guess am I tired after the Tuuli/Ducati set? 570 kg of granite tiles in and out.
